Unlocking New Career Opportunities with a DevOps Engineer Course


In today’s rapidly evolving tech landscape, companies are constantly seeking ways to deliver software faster, more efficiently, and with fewer errors. To meet these demands, the DevOps methodology has become a critical component of modern software development and IT operations. As a result, the demand for professionals skilled in DevOps is growing fast. One of the best ways to gain these in-demand skills is by enrolling in a DevOps engineer course.

Whether you're an IT professional, software developer, system administrator, or someone looking to break into the tech industry, taking a DevOps engineer course can significantly enhance your career prospects. This article explores what DevOps is, why it's important, and how the right course can help you become a successful DevOps engineer.

What is DevOps?

DevOps is a combination of cultural philosophies, practices, and tools that increases an organization’s ability to deliver applications and services at high velocity. It bridges the gap between development and operations teams, fostering a culture of collaboration, automation, and continuous improvement.

The core principles of DevOps include:

Continuous Integration (CI): Merging code changes frequently and automatically testing them.

Continuous Delivery (CD): Automating the release of software to ensure rapid and reliable deployments.

Infrastructure as Code (IaC): Managing infrastructure through machine-readable configuration files.

Monitoring and Feedback Loops: Using real-time metrics to improve system performance and user experience.

These practices lead to faster development cycles, increased deployment frequency, and more stable operating environments.

Why Learn DevOps?

DevOps is not just a trend — it’s a necessity for modern organizations. Companies are moving toward cloud-native technologies, automation, and agile workflows, making DevOps skills highly valuable in today’s job market.

Here’s why learning DevOps through a DevOps engineer course is a smart investment:

1. High Demand for DevOps Engineers

As more businesses embrace digital transformation, the demand for DevOps professionals has skyrocketed. A simple job search reveals thousands of open roles globally, many of which come with attractive salaries and benefits. DevOps engineers are among the top earners in tech, often making six-figure incomes.

2. Versatile Career Path

DevOps skills are applicable across various industries — from finance and healthcare to e-commerce and gaming. With a solid DevOps background, you can work in roles such as DevOps engineer, site reliability engineer (SRE), automation architect, or cloud engineer.

3. Increased Efficiency and Impact

DevOps professionals are directly involved in improving workflows, reducing deployment times, and enhancing software quality. This makes their work impactful and essential to the success of digital products and services.

What You’ll Learn in a DevOps Engineer Course

A comprehensive DevOps engineer course provides both theoretical foundations and hands-on practice. Here are the core areas typically covered:

1. Linux and Scripting

Most DevOps environments rely on Linux-based systems. Learning the basics of Linux and shell scripting (Bash, Python, etc.) is essential.

2. Version Control with Git

You’ll learn how to use Git for source code management and collaborate effectively using platforms like GitHub or GitLab.

3. CI/CD Pipelines

Setting up and managing continuous integration and delivery pipelines using tools like Jenkins, GitLab CI, CircleCI, or GitHub Actions.

4. Containerization and Orchestration

Understanding Docker and Kubernetes is vital. These tools allow developers to package applications and deploy them consistently across environments.

5. Cloud Platforms

Most DevOps roles involve working with cloud providers like AWS, Microsoft Azure, or Google Cloud Platform (GCP). Courses often cover how to deploy and manage infrastructure in the cloud.

6. Infrastructure as Code (IaC)

Learn to automate infrastructure provisioning using tools like Terraform, AWS CloudFormation, or Ansible.

7. Monitoring and Logging

You'll also be trained on monitoring tools like Prometheus, Grafana, ELK Stack, and others to track application performance and troubleshoot issues.

Some advanced courses include real-world projects and labs that simulate real DevOps challenges — a valuable feature when preparing for job interviews or certifications.

How to Choose the Right DevOps Engineer Course

With countless options available online, picking the right DevOps engineer course can be tricky. Here’s what to look for:

Up-to-date Curriculum: Ensure the course includes the latest tools and technologies used in modern DevOps environments.

Hands-on Labs and Projects: Practical experience is crucial. Choose a course that emphasizes real-world applications.

Instructor Expertise: Look for instructors with real-world DevOps experience and strong teaching credentials.

Community and Support: Some courses offer peer groups, mentorship, or Q&A support — helpful for beginners.

Certification Options: A course that prepares you for certifications like Docker Certified Associate, AWS Certified DevOps Engineer, or Kubernetes Administrator adds value.

Popular platforms offering DevOps engineer courses include Coursera, Udemy, edX, Pluralsight, and LinkedIn Learning. Many also offer flexible schedules, making it easy to learn at your own pace.

The Career Benefits of a DevOps Engineer Course

Taking a DevOps engineer course is not just about gaining new skills — it's about transforming your career. Here’s how such a course can benefit you long-term:

Boost Your Resume: Adding DevOps skills makes you stand out in a competitive job market.

Prepare for Certification: Many courses align with industry certifications that can validate your expertise.

Increase Your Earning Potential: Certified DevOps professionals often command higher salaries.

Job Flexibility: Remote and hybrid roles are common in DevOps, giving you greater work-life balance.

Stay Future-Proof: As automation and cloud technologies evolve, DevOps skills ensure you stay relevant.

Conclusion

As technology continues to advance, the need for skilled DevOps professionals is only going to grow. By enrolling in a DevOps engineer course, you're not just learning new tools — you're preparing for a future-proof career in one of the most impactful areas of tech.

Comments

Popular posts from this blog

azure devops certification cost

microsoft devops course

How to Get the Google Machine Learning Certification Free: A Complete Guide